March 5 Detroit NFPA/FPIC Regional Conference Lineup Released

2020 Detroit NFPA/FPIC Regional Conference
March 5, 2020 | 7:30 AM – 1:00 PM
Lawrence Technological University, Southfield, Michigan

Expand your knowledge of advanced sensor technologies for fluid power systems at the March 5 NFPA/FPIC Regional Conference, presented by NFPA and MSOE’s Fluid Power Industrial Consortium (FPIC). The speaker lineup for this event has been finalized:

  • The End of Reactive Maintenance: Today’s Predictive Solutions for a Proactive Future | Kris Mikulan, Group Product Manager, Filter Systems, Schroeder Industries and Anthony Maiolo, Application Engineer, Schroeder Industries
  • Novel Position Sensors for Closed Loop Servo-Hydraulics | Art Holzknecht, District Manager, Renishaw, Inc and Matjaz Sivec, LinAce™ Sensors Engineering Manager, Renishaw, Inc
  • Autonomy: How Close is the Future? | Marcus Herrera, Sales Application Engineer – Sensors and Controls, HYDAC
  • Reducing Cost of Field Operations Using HART Technology | Leslie Perez, Senior Product Manager, Barksdale, Inc and Steve Brown, Key Account Manager, Barksdale, Inc

The half-day conference will offer ample opportunities to make the right connections with others in the industry while learning about advanced sensor technologies. The morning kicks off with breakfast and networking time before diving right into the presentations covering predictive solutions in fluid power sensor technologies. Discuss these concepts and make meaningful connections with other attendees during the break or during the structured networking and discussion time over lunch.

Registration for the event is open and is free to NFPA and FPIC members.*

*Non-members are welcome to attend but will be charged a $250 registration fee.
